RESEARCH ON THE INFLUENCE OF THE NATURE OF THE LIGAND ON THE STEREOCHEMISTRY TRY OF THE NICKEL (II) AND OTHER 1ST ROW TRANSITION METAL COMPLEXES WITH SCHIFF BASES.

Abstract

The solid and liquid state steric configurations of several bis-(N-alkylsalicylaldimino)-nickel (II) complexes were examined spectrophotometrically and by magnetic and dielectric polarization measurements. It was found that the n-propyl derivatives are planar, the t-butyl derivatives pseudo-tetrahedral, and the secalkyl derivatives either planar or pseudo-tetrahedral. Thermochemical, electronic, and steric implications are discussed. R-N-salicylaldimine-cobalt(III) complexes were found to exist in the trans-octahedral configuration only.
